Lt. Taylor Culbreath, Malvern Fire Dept., along with Staff Sgt. Martelle Miller, and Spc. Joslyn Burton, 39th Brigade Support Battalion, set up a potable water station, April 6, 2025, to support the City of Malvern and the surrounding communities until services can be restored.
The Arkansas Guardsmen delivered potable water after a lighting strike caused a catastrophic failure to the town’s water supply system.
The water tanker, commonly referred to as a “HIPPO,” can supply 2,000 gallons of water.
The Soldiers will continue to assist Malvern's Fire Department and Emergency Response Team until they are no longer needed.
The Governor has mobilized more than 50 Arkansas National Guardsmen to support and augment civil authorities, where needed.
